Medical Crowdfunding in India: The Need for a Strong Legal Enforcement System

Medical crowdfunding is growing in India due to poor health insurance and high out-of-pocket costs for critical illnesses. This rise necessitates better regulation to protect patient rights and manage digital health fundraising effectively.
Area of Science:
- Healthcare economics
- Digital health
- Public health policy
Background:
- Limited health insurance coverage in India leads to significant out-of-pocket expenditures for patients.
- Chronic, rare, and life-threatening diseases impose a substantial financial burden on individuals and families.
Purpose of the Study:
- To analyze the growth and impact of medical crowdfunding in India.
- To identify the challenges associated with medical crowdfunding platforms.
- To highlight the need for regulatory frameworks in digital health fundraising.
Main Methods:
- Review of the current landscape of medical crowdfunding in India.
- Analysis of the increasing number of digital fundraising platforms.
- Examination of the implications for patient rights and the healthcare sector.
Main Results:
- Medical crowdfunding has emerged as a significant financial recourse for healthcare in India.
- The proliferation of digital fundraising platforms presents both opportunities and challenges.
- There is a notable impact on the healthcare sector and patient rights due to increased digital transactions.
Conclusions:
- The expansion of medical crowdfunding in India underscores gaps in existing health insurance and financial support systems.
- Effective regulation and government guidelines are crucial for the sustainable growth of medical crowdfunding.
- Strengthening legal enforcement is essential to safeguard patient interests in the evolving digital health fundraising ecosystem.
